Queen's Birthday Australia : Second Monday in June

Except for Western Australia, all states and territories in the country observe the Queen's Birthday on the second Monday in June. As this date was to close to Western Australia Day (formerly referred to as Foundation Day) celebrated on the first Monday in June, the Queen's Birthday public holiday in Western Australia was moved to September/October.

 

The Queen's Birthday public holiday is the chosen date to celebrate the birthday of the monarch of the Commonwealth countries, currently Queen Elizabeth II. The date does not coincide with the actual birthday of the Queen (being April 21).

 

On the Queen's Birthday traditionally the Queen's Birthday honours list is published. The list contains the names of the new members of the Order of Australia and other Australian honours. The different grades of honour are awarded to Australian citizens and other individuals to recognise their achievements in Australian society or for meritorious service.
